This journal focuses on the molecular mechanisms and therapeutic strategies related to cancer progression, drug resistance, and the tumor microenvironment. It covers topics such as cancer stem cells, epigenetic modifications, metabolic reprogramming, immune evasion, and the role of specific proteins and signaling pathways in tumorigenesis. The journal also explores novel therapeutic approaches including nanomedicine, molecular glues, and combination therapies, as well as the interplay between aging, comorbidities, and cancer.
